I have a new Volvo friend locally who is trying to remove his crankpulley to do the timing belt. He got the bolt out no problem, but the harmonic balancer/crank pulley does not want to come off. It has been about 20 years since I last did this but I don't recall having issues removing it. I had to remove the belt pulley and that was a real swine to get off I recall.

Has anyone done this and had this issue and have a simple way to remove it?

I can't use a typical 3 legged puller as you can't pull on the outside as you can damage the rubber middle section, and you can't safely use heat for the same reason.

Haynes manual for 240 engines (740 Volvos are very similar) says to use only a puller that threads in to the PULLEY HUB. Not ouside edge as you said will damage the rubber.

Volvo dealer service manager (former master tech who worked on these), said careful use of a couple of pry bars and not pressing on the outer steel rim works. Sure enough about 2 hours later a get a text saying it has come off.
